Workers Compensation Lawyers Can Help You Get the Benefits You Deserve

Workers compensation lawyers can assist you receive the benefits that you deserve, regardless of whether you were injured on the job or are suffering from a serious medical condition.

Finding the right benefits can be a challenge and confusing. It is recommended that you get a knowledgeable lawyer to guide you through the process.

Benefits

Your case can be helped by workers compensation lawyers. They can help you no matter if you're seeking lost wages as a result of an accident at work, or damages for pain and suffering resulting from your employer's negligence.

A skilled lawyer can negotiate with an insurance company that could be averse to you. These professionals are familiar with the tactics used by insurance companies to deny claims , or to convince applicants to accept less than they are entitled to.

They may also be able to fight for your right to medical treatment and medical attention regardless of whether the condition or injury is life-threatening or permanent. This is an important aspect of any claim as the experts know that insurance companies are more likely than not to provide fair and complete settlements.

In addition, they may help to protect you against being retaliated against by your employer for filing a work-related accident claim. Employers often attempt to punish injured employees who file a claim by shaming or firing them, cutting their hours or restraining them from returning to work too soon.

They can also help you obtain the maximum benefits from workers' compensation that the law in your state requires. These benefits usually cover wage replacement, vocational rehabilitation, and medical expenses as well as any other expenses that arise from an employee's workplace injury.

However, while these benefits can be crucial in times of financial distress but they're not always enough. Workers' compensation attorneys may also pursue third-party claims to increase the value of a worker’s claim.

These claims can lead to five-, six- and even seven-figure amounts. They are also brought against subcontractors, suppliers and vendors.

The process of pursuing an injury claim can be confusing and frustrating for any person, but it can be especially difficult if you already have a condition. This can lead to the insurance company blaming your new injury on a preexisting condition. In this scenario, compensation may be underpaid.

If you have suffered an injury at work, it is important to consult a workers' comp attorney immediately. They can assist you in all aspects, including communicating with medical professionals and help with filling out the necessary paperwork. They can also help simplify legal procedures and reduce the stress associated with a complex claim.

Representation

If you're a victim of a worker's compensation claim, you need that you hire an attorney represent you. An attorney can help you through the process, complete all paperwork, and defend your rights. A lawyer may also help you negotiate a settlement with your insurance company to earn more than you would have earned on your own.

Workers' compensation is a type insurance policy that provides compensation for employees who suffer injuries or become sick due to workplace accidents. In exchange for these benefits, workers are required to refrain from suing their employers in civil court for negligence.

Even if you do have a valid claim the employer or insurance company will fight it. They have lawyers who specialize in minimizing your workers' compensation benefits and pressing for you to settle for a minimal settlement that won't cover your lost wages and outstanding medical bills.

It's not always simple to win a workers' compensation law firm compensation case, especially if your injury is long-lasting or severe. The insurance company will try to limit your benefits so they don't have to bear massive medical costs and treatment expenses or attempt to deny your claim entirely.

A skilled Workers' Compensation lawyer can assist you with the process and present compelling evidence to back your claim. This will ensure that you get the most benefits. They can also help you with your appeal in the event that the company rejects your claim.

Workers' compensation lawyers can also review your medical records to document any underlying issues that could impact your claim. They can also prepare your testimony and cross-examine the insurance company's witnesses, making sure you tell the truth and presenting a strong case.

Some lawyers charge a flat fee , while others take a percentage of any settlement. The amount will depend on whether your case was decidedly won or lost and the amount of damage you receive.

Fees

Workers compensation lawyers typically work on a contingent fee basis. This means that you won't have to pay them unless you succeed in your case. This is a great way to make sure you get the legal representation that you require without having to worry about paying for services out of your own pocket.

Many states have laws that restrict the number of lawyers who are able to handle workers claims for compensation. This varies from state to state, but generally speaking it's a cap of 10 to 25 percent of the attorney's overall recovery amount.

You can also save money by hiring a lawyer who has a track record of success in workers' compensation cases. These lawyers know how to argue your case and will be able to get the attention of insurance companies and employers in order to ensure you get the maximum benefits available.

A good lawyer will ensure that you're receiving the medical treatment you require to heal in the shortest time possible. This can be difficult because workers' compensation is usually complicated and doctors are not paid until the case is resolved.

A workers' compensation attorney compensation lawyer can also assist you in gathering evidence to support your claim, like photographs or testimony from witnesses of your injuries. The lawyer can also assist you with forms and other tasks that can be difficult or frustrating.

The charges associated with the cost of a workers' compensation lawyer are a small price to pay for the services they provide. Most of the time injured workers are able to receive more compensation - even after paying the fees that are involved - than they had if they didn't employ lawyers at all.

A lawyer is a great resource to have in every situation, no matter if it's a straightforward case or one that has more complicated issues. A lawyer can be extremely helpful when you've been injured that is more serious , or you're dealing with objections from your employer or their insurance company.

Timeframe

If you've suffered an injury at work in New York, it's important to understand the timeline that determines the date when your workers' compensation benefits begin. In seeking help from a skilled NYC workers' compensation lawyer as soon as you will make the process go more smoothly.

It is crucial to begin the workers' compensation claim process by filing a report with your employer within 10 days of the workplace accident. This is the C-2 form (Employer’s Report of Work-related injuries).

After you file the report after you file the report, the Workers' Comp Board will have already received information about your injury by the time they receive it. The Workers Compensation Board will examine the report to determine if you are eligible for benefits and what amount you can receive.

After you have been approved for benefits, your insurance company begins to pay you every two weeks until Maximum Medical Improvement (MMI), when you are unable to to work at the same amount or when the benefits period expires. In most cases, this will take between 18 and 29 days.

It is a good idea for you to stay in touch with your lawyer throughout the course of your case through the claims process. This will ensure that you are receiving all of the information you require and that all parties involved in your case are following proper steps.

If your claim is rejected by the insurance company, you may be able to talk to your attorney regarding scheduling hearings. This will give you the opportunity to argue your version of the story, present evidence and witness on your behalf.

You are entitled to appeal in the event of a denial. This would require an appearance before an Workers Compensation Law Judge who will decide whether or not your claim is valid. It's important to choose a skilled workers' compensation lawyer represent you in this hearing, as they will have the expertise and resources required to present your case well.

The workers' compensation lawyer who you choose to represent will also be responsible for filling out all of the necessary forms and ensuring that everyone involved with your claim follows the appropriate procedure. This can reduce the stress of the workers' compensation process.
